Lurk, Leap, Loot (2023 7DRL)
About
Sneak into mansions, map them, steal all the loot and escape! Coffee-break turn-based stealth inspired by Looking Glass Studios' Thief games.
The thieves' guild has tasked you with mapping out ten of the most opulent mansions in the city, for future big heists. In the meantime you are free to keep any loose valuables you may find. The game's final score is based on how much of the loot you have collected and hung onto.
Created by James McNeill and Damien Moore for the 2023 Seven-Day Roguelike Challenge. Source is on Github.
We started from ThiefRL2, a previous 7DRL entry of mine, so it will be familiar if you've played that. Here are some of the changes:
- Player movement changed from 8-way to 4-way, plus a "leap" mechanic
- Guards patrol routes now instead of wandering randomly
- New tileset by Damien Moore
- Voiced dialogue and sound effects
- Torches that can be lit or doused; guards can carry torches
- An ending. Can you get all the loot?
